2009 Kia Mesa SUV - Official Teaser Pictures
Alleged to be the first official teaser images of the Kia Mesa SUV, these pictures give us a glimpse of what to expect from the forthcoming production version of the KCD II Mesa concept which was presented at the 2005 Detroit Motor Show. You can see a few styling cues from the KCD II concept in these pics like the broad grille and boxy shape of the front end, and well that’s about all.

Unfortunately, we don’t have any official information whatsoever, but it wouldn’t be far fetched at all if we said that the Mesa is will be based on the Hyundai Veracruz full-size SUV. Thus meaning that Kia’s 7seater SUV will probably be offered with the same 260Hp 3.8-litre V6 petrol unit.
